K krenwic Well-known member Joined Jan 20, 2005 Messages 102 Reaction score 0 Location Newberry, SC Apr 7, 2009 #4 Went to the sale and these were the announced averages. 346 Bulls $ 5,223 41 Donors 10,884 110 Pairs 4,018 111 Bred Cows 2,338 138 Bred Hfrs 3,372 60 Spring ETs 4,393 229 Com. Bred Hfrs 1,459 Gross $ 4,023,150 krenwic
